# Build Provenance — Proctorline Exam Queue

For this week's sync: the exam-proctoring queue service now ships with signed provenance. Every artifact records its source revision, builder identity, and dependency lockfile digest, verified at deploy time by the Lathbury admission controller. Unsigned builds are rejected in staging as of Monday; prod enforcement follows next sprint. Nothing changes for feature work — just don't hand-build images. The current verified release token appears below.

pipeline stamp: htk9_b3279b371

## Runbook: Coldvault archival

Buckets idle for 180 days are moved from the Coldvault standard tier to deep archive by the Permafrost sweeper. Objects remain encrypted at rest throughout; legal-hold buckets are skipped automatically. Restores take up to 12 hours and require approver sign-off. The sweeper currently runs with the following configuration.

settings of tagef-bawif:
DRUIX_HOST=druix.zemvarlabs.internal
DRUIX_PORT=8000

**Vendor note: Inkmill markdown pipeline**

Rendering for Parchway docs is outsourced to Inkmill under an annual contract, renewing each March. They handle sanitization and PDF export; we own the upload queue. SLA: 4-hour response on rendering failures. Escalate only after two failed retries. Their support desk is reachable at the address below.

billing contact of hahaf-baguf = zorael.tammir.jorius@sivrelhq.internal

# Service Accounts: Image Slimming (Shrinkray)

Heads up for the sync — Shrinkray now strips debug symbols and unused locales from all base images before they hit the Crateport registry, cutting average image size by 60%. It runs under the `svc-shrinkray` account, which only has pull/push on the staging namespace. For local testing, Shrinkray talks to the Crateport metadata API using the key below.

service key, fawip-bajef: kto11_Qt5wZK9vdNC